WebMar 6, 2024 · What is the initial volume if gas was heated from 270°C to 342°C? 662.2 mL, assuming that the final volume is 750 mL. To calculate this: Convert temperatures to Kelvins: T₁ = 543.2 K, T₂ = 615.2 K. Write Charles' law: V₁/T₁ = V₂/T₂. Solve for V₁: V₁ = (T₁×V₂)/T₂. WebFind the volume of container 1. Assume that the temperature and quantity of the gas remain constant. Given, Initial pressure, P 1 = 3kPa Final pressure, P 2 = 6kPa Final volume, V 2 = 10L According to Boyle’s law, V 1 = (P 2 V 2 )/P 1 V 1 = (6 kPa * 10 L)/3 kPa = 20 L Therefore, the volume of container 1 is 20 L.
